The COMPASS system uses a point-driven approach to assess EP applicants based on criteria such as salary, qualifications, diversity, and support for local employment. Applicants need to score a total of 40 points within the Foundational Criteria to pass this stage. ...

Employment Pass (EP) Have a job offer in Singapore. Work in a managerial, executive or specialised job. Earn a fixed monthly salary of at least $3,600 (more experienced candidates need higher salaries). Have acceptable qualifications, usually a good university degree, professional qualifications ...
